Join Our Trauma-Informed Mental Health Team We are a growing, trauma-specialized mental health group practice dedicated to fostering healing and transformation. Our work specializes in trauma-informed approaches, including EMDR, Internal Family Systems (IFS), somatic therapies, DBT, and mindfulness techniques. We are looking for a licensed mental health professional in Utah (LCSW, CSW, CMHC, ACMHC, or equivalent) who has a strong background in working with trauma and complex PTSD. The ideal candidate is someone who is deeply committed to helping clients heal, thrives in a team environment, and values ongoing learning and professional growth. Full-Time Hours
: Minimum of 28 client sessions per week ~ Attendance at weekly staff meetings and group supervision is required ~ Paid Time Off (PTO) and mental health days ~ Paid holidays ~ A private office space ~ We are deeply committed to diversity, inclusion, and creating a workplace where everyone feels valued. We value balance and self-care, knowing that a healthy team is essential for impactful client care. Our practice primarily serves adults, adolescents, and families navigating the complexities of trauma, grief, and loss. We understand the importance of balance and offer flexible scheduling options to support your personal and professional needs.
